You Can't Catch Me

par Catherine McKenzie

"Twelve years ago Jessica Williams escaped a cult. Thanks to the private detective who rescued her, she reintegrated into society, endured an uncomfortable notoriety, and tried to put it all behind her. Then, at an airport bar, Jessica meets a woman with an identical name and birth date. It appears to be just an odd coincidence--until a week later, when Jessica finds her bank account drained and her personal information stolen. Following a trail of the grifter's victims, each with the same name, Jessica gathers players--one by one--for her own game. According to her plan, they'll set a trap and wait for the impostor to strike again. But plans can go awry, and trust can fray, and as Jessica tries to escape the shadows of her childhood, the risks are greater than she imagined. Now, confronting the casualties of her past, Jessica can't help but wonder... Who will pay the price?"--Provided by publisher.… (plus d'informations)

Jessica Williams has just been fired from her investigative journalism job for plagiarism. She decides to go to a resort in Mexico to escape the press coverage. While waiting at the airport, she finds a woman with the exact same name. After playing a game of twenty questions to see what other similarities they share, they exchange contact information. When Jessica returns home from Mexico, she discovers large cash withdrawals have been made from her bank account and that Jessica Two is the one who took the money. After doing some digging, convinced she's pulled this scam before, Jessica is determined to catch Jessica Two by reaching out to other Jessica's on Facebook. When she gets some responses from other victim's, she sets a plan in motion.

The concept of this book about identity theft specific to financial scams (not the ongoing destruction of an individual's credit and future life) had potential, but I found the execution lacking. There is an an added element in that some of the principal characters had been involved with a cult.

The biggest problem for me was inconsistent pacing. Descriptions of some events were dragged out far longer than necessary since they added nothing to the story line or the tension necessary in a psychological thriller, while the big reveal at the end was condensed into just a few abruptly delivered pages.

There were also too many options where it was necessary to suspend disbelief in order for the convoluted plot to move forward. And although the key to the ending was withheld throughout the book, other supposed surprises were pretty obvious to me early on, and fell flat.

Sometimes books that require us to accept unlikely coincidences or seemingly preposterous plots are redeemed by excellent writing or appealing characters. That wasn't the case here.
